你好,为什么我的粒子在电脑开发版都正常,但是在手机上就不显示。(使用微信网页浏览)
不是一个,是我这里所有的粒子都这样
文件如下:
black_smoke.zip (74.6 KB)
控制台会打印:_ccsg.ParticleSystem:unknown image format with Data
但是之前panda说这个打印是没关系的
你好,为什么我的粒子在电脑开发版都正常,但是在手机上就不显示。(使用微信网页浏览)
不是一个,是我这里所有的粒子都这样
文件如下:
black_smoke.zip (74.6 KB)
控制台会打印:_ccsg.ParticleSystem:unknown image format with Data
但是之前panda说这个打印是没关系的
我没说过这话吧,这个报错的原因是图片格式不对(不是 png),所以解析失败,难道你用的是 webp ?
看了下是jare说的
http://forum.cocos.com/t/particle/51567
这种粒子是没有PNG图片的,而是将PNG的数据直接转成了BASE64编码放到了particle的PLIST文件中,比如:
textureFileName
baozhaqi_1.png
textureImageData
eJwcmwVYU30bxqco0vAC0iXd3akIo7uR7gbpRknpHN2NlHR3ju4O6Y7RzXf8rosxrm3n7B/Pc9+/+2yEKspLoCIRIIFAIFQpSTFlEOiN…
现在出问题的好像基本都是粒子,而且不同的手机表现还不同。我怀疑是blend的原因
我发现这个粒子的问题了,在webgl下不显示,在CANVAS下面反而显示,很奇怪,麻烦看一看这个问题
有没有人帮我看看啊,粒子几乎全部要重做。在电脑上webgl 不显示,canvas显示。在手机上webgl和canvas都不显示。
都是H5版本,请问是怎么回事啊,怎么解决啊
发现一个很奇怪的现象,估计BUG就在这里了。麻烦解答下:
首先,在电脑上,CANVAS显示粒子,webgl就不显示,
我用手机扫了一下CREATOR又上角的“设备扫一扫,可直接预览”,那个二维码。但是手机中出现的总是WEBGL,于是我就去previwe-templates\boot.js中的cc.game.run的option.renderMode改成了1,。然后进游戏,显示确实是canvas,而且粒子也显示了出来。
但是最奇怪的是,当我用项目-》构建发布-》渲染模式:CANVAS,这样发布出来,传到网站上,同样用手机去浏览,而且打印出来的确实也是CANVAS,但是粒子就是不显示。
所以我觉得粒子是可以在手机上显示,但是就是不知道用手机扫一扫右上角的二维码和发布出来后,到底哪里不同?请帮我看一下,谢谢
这种问题不能烂尾啊! 官方得跟踪问题, 反馈到这里啊!~
我帮顶一下.
楼主找到办法了吗?我也碰到这个问题了
这问题已经烂尾了,无解 - -